数据分析菜鸟,应该怎么开始学习?专业不是统计学,不是市场营销
如题求大神帮忙
给您以下建议:
1、需要掌握基础知识。数据挖掘有三个基础:数据库(oracle、mysql、sqlserver、db2等)、数学(尤其是统计学)、数据挖掘工具(spss、sas、matlab、r、python等)。括号中列出的不必全部掌握,只要根据实际需要掌握1~2种。
2、需要了解一定的行业背景或有一定行业经验。比如您所从事的是金融?电信?互联网?企业管理?
3、最好了解或掌握一些大数据技术,比如hadoop、hive、mapreduce、spark、storm、kafka等,这是未来的发展趋势。
4、需要做一些小项目来提高数据挖掘技能。如果没有实际项目,可以使用加州大学欧文分校的数据集(UCI数据)磨练经验。
至于书籍,你可以参照以上4点寻找一些资料、文献、讲义。。。不一定非得是书
做到上面4点后,你可以成为一个还不错的数据分析师。后面还有两条路可选:
1、如果想做算法专家或数据科学家(好多米),需要在数学(相当重要,除了统计学,还有最优化、线性代数、泛函等,这些是某些前沿算法如神经网络、深度学习、SVM等的基础)、计算机(也相当重要,除了spss这类简单工具,还要掌握python、scala、java等其中的一种,方便你摆脱束缚,自由的设计和测试算法)和机器学习上下功夫,最终蛹变蝶飞,成为技术大神派。
2、如果你想成为资深数据分析师,那需要好好掌握行业知识,多做项目,积累项目经验和行业经验,不止技术、经验过硬,PPT、文档、口才也要漂亮,成为综合实力派。
最后一句忠告,您所选的这条路前途是光明的,但道路是曲折的,必须努力,才能成功。
资深数据分析师
页:
[1]